The Imperative of Transparency in Digital Gambling Audits
In an era where digital gambling platforms like BeGamblewareSlots operate at the intersection of entertainment and responsibility, transparency in audits emerges as a cornerstone of ethical design. At its core, transparency means making audit processes visible, verifiable, and understandable—not just to regulators, but to users who place their trust in these systems. This principle actively counteracts risks of exploitation and hidden biases that can distort outcomes, especially in complex environments such as digital slot machines powered by blockchain technology.
Without transparent audit trails, hidden algorithmic biases or manipulated payout rates risk undermining user confidence and public trust. Audits serve as the backbone of accountability, ensuring randomness verification, fair payouts, and intact data integrity. When these processes are opaque, users face uncertainty, and platforms risk reputational and legal consequences. Transparent audits transform suspicion into confidence, aligning digital gambling with responsible innovation.
Building on this, audit integrity directly fuels long-term platform sustainability. Transparent reporting and independent verification foster loyalty, reduce churn, and support compliance with evolving regulatory expectations—elements essential for platforms aiming to thrive ethically in competitive markets.
Emerging Risks in Digital Slots: NFTs as Gambling Tokens
The integration of NFTs into BeGamblewareSlots-style platforms introduces novel gambling mechanics, where unique digital assets become wagers. This shift amplifies risks tied to audit transparency: blockchain’s immutability offers promise but also complexity. While every transaction is recorded, interpreting and verifying fairness requires granular audit access beyond simple transaction logs.
Tokenized assets challenge traditional monitoring methods. Unlike static slot tickets, NFT slots involve dynamic ownership, transfer history, and variable payout conditions—all requiring auditors to track both blockchain data and real-time gameplay behavior. Without clear, accessible audit frameworks, users face heightened exposure to unmonitored volatility and opaque reward structures.

Auditing BeGamblewareSlots: Technical and Ethical Dimensions
Core to any digital slot audit are three pillars: randomness verification, payout fairness, and data integrity. Advanced tools now use statistical sampling, cryptographic RNG checks, and blockchain analytics to validate these components. For platforms like BeGamblewareSlots, audit transparency means not only conducting these tests but making findings accessible—through open reports, public logs, and verifiable certifications.
Transparency enables independent verification, allowing researchers, regulators, and users to scrutinize outcomes without relying solely on platform claims. This public scrutiny strengthens integrity and deters misconduct.
However, standardizing audit criteria remains challenging amid rapid innovation. Evolving features such as adaptive difficulty, bonus mechanics, and NFT integration demand flexible yet rigorous frameworks. Collaboration across industry, regulators, and audit bodies is essential to establish consistent benchmarks that protect users while enabling innovation.
